Output 96eccc54cabbe0f9a6e3a156f3f49b81361ca1f1b03cfdf468a9bd023c6fc06e:1

value
18201055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07d6553bdd73905863380a2c14c9ebe4acad7f6c OP_EQUAL
address
32QTQzzQvvkEmDG5WA2XVsuXYB9L2Hopa2
transaction
96eccc54cabbe0f9a6e3a156f3f49b81361ca1f1b03cfdf468a9bd023c6fc06e
spent
true